Common mistakes
Confusing market share with market size
Assuming that a company's market share equals the total market sales.
Fix itMarket share is the proportion of total market sales that a company captures, while market size is the overall sales volume of the market.
Mixing up product and service mix
Assuming the product mix only refers to physical goods.
Fix itThe product mix includes all goods and services a firm offers; the service mix is a subset of the product mix.
